WebMar 17, 2024 · Unordered map is an associative container that contains key-value pairs with unique keys. Search, insertion, and removal of elements have average constant-time complexity. WebDec 4, 2024 · HashMap LinkedHashMap TreeMap; Time complexity (Big O) for get, put, containsKey and remove method. O(1) O(1) O(log n) Null Keys. Allowed. Allowed. Not allowed if the key uses natural ordering or the comparator does not support comparison on null keys. Interface. Map. Map. Map, SortedMap and NavigableMap.
